STEP 1B. INSTALL YOUR PRESETS MANUALLY
With Lightroom open, go to:
If you have a PC: Edit > Preferences. If you have a MAC: Lightroom > Preferences.
This will open a new window. In this window, you will see a tab labeled “store presets with this catalog”. Make sure this is unchecked.
Go to the “Presets” tab and click on the “Show Lightroom Presets Folder” button. This will open Adobe folders on your computer.
Click to open the “Lightroom” folder. Then click to open the “Develop Presets” folder.
STEP 2: PASTE IN THE PRESETS
If you have not installed any presets in the past, you will only see a folder called “user presets”. Do not install your presets in the "user presets" folder. If you have installed other presets in the past, you will see them listed in the "develop presets" folder. Copy the presets that you downloaded in step 2 and paste them into the “develop presets” folder. This includes tool and layer presets, but not brushes.
STEP 3: CLOSE AND RE-OPEN LIGHTROOM
Now, completely close Lightroom. When you re-open Lightroom, your presets will be installed.
STEP 4: START USING THE PRESETS
First, make sure that you have a photo loaded, otherwise your presets may not show up in the menu. To access your presets, go to the develop module and you will see them on the left hand side. Click on the name of any preset to apply it to your photo.
